Transaction a21dd6af2fb3a3ce42b64f53feb0abb1e20a5fba8c03acd3051547c4e55333b8

block
8edbe729c52a591b73b98493923743ae68b30f1fd7c8a43ea151f91dbc454f52

56 Inputs

2 Outputs